Công cụ chẩn đoán mạng máy tính

Nhập thông tin về tình trạng kết nối của máy tính để chẩn đoán nguyên nhân và giải pháp

Kết quả chẩn đoán

Hướng dẫn khắc phục máy tính có mạng nhưng không kết nối được internet

Tình trạng máy tính hiển thị biểu tượng mạng nhưng không thể truy cập internet là vấn đề phổ biến mà nhiều người dùng gặp phải. Nguyên nhân có thể xuất phát từ nhiều yếu tố khác nhau, từ cấu hình sai trên máy tính đến sự cố từ nhà cung cấp dịch vụ internet (ISP). Bài viết này sẽ cung cấp hướng dẫn chi tiết từ cơ bản đến nâng cao để giúp bạn khắc phục sự cố này.

1. Kiểm tra các bước cơ bản trước tiên

Trước khi đi sâu vào các giải pháp phức tạp, hãy thực hiện các bước kiểm tra cơ bản sau:

  1. Kiểm tra kết nối vật lý: Đối với kết nối có dây, đảm bảo cáp Ethernet được cắm chặt vào cả máy tính và bộ định tuyến. Đối với Wi-Fi, đảm bảo bạn đã bật Wi-Fi trên máy tính và đang kết nối với đúng mạng.
  2. Khởi động lại thiết bị: Khởi động lại máy tính, bộ định tuyến và modem. Thao tác đơn giản này giải quyết được đến 50% các sự cố kết nối.
  3. Kiểm tra thiết bị khác: Thử kết nối thiết bị khác (điện thoại, máy tính bảng) với cùng mạng để xác định liệu vấn đề có phải từ máy tính của bạn hay từ toàn bộ mạng.
  4. Kiểm tra đèn báo trên modem/router: Đèn Internet (thường có biểu tượng quả địa cầu) phải sáng xanh hoặc trắng ổn định. Nếu đèn nhấp nháy hoặc màu khác (đỏ, cam), có thể có sự cố từ nhà cung cấp.

2. Chẩn đoán sâu hơn trên máy tính

2.1 Sử dụng Command Prompt (Windows) hoặc Terminal (macOS/Linux)

Các lệnh sau sẽ giúp bạn xác định vấn đề:

  • ipconfig /all (Windows) hoặc ifconfig (macOS/Linux): Kiểm tra địa chỉ IP của máy tính. Nếu địa chỉ IP bắt đầu bằng 169.254.x.x, máy tính không nhận được IP hợp lệ từ bộ định tuyến.
  • ping 8.8.8.8: Kiểm tra liệu máy tính có thể kết nối với DNS của Google không. Nếu thành công nhưng không vào được web, vấn đề có thể nằm ở cấu hình DNS.
  • ping google.com: Nếu lệnh này thất bại nhưng ping 8.8.8.8 thành công, vấn đề chắc chắn liên quan đến DNS.
  • tracert google.com: Xem đường đi của gói tin để xác định điểm đứt quãng.

2.2 Kiểm tra cài đặt mạng

Trên Windows:

  1. Mở Control Panel > Network and Sharing Center > Change adapter settings.
  2. Nhấp chuột phải vào kết nối mạng đang sử dụng (Wi-Fi hoặc Ethernet) và chọn Properties.
  3. Đảm bảo các mục sau được chọn:
    • Client for Microsoft Networks
    • File and Printer Sharing for Microsoft Networks
    • Internet Protocol Version 4 (TCP/IPv4)
    • Internet Protocol Version 6 (TCP/IPv6)
  4. Nhấp đúp vào Internet Protocol Version 4 (TCP/IPv4) và đảm bảo máy tính được cấu hình để nhận IP và DNS tự động.

Trên macOS:

  1. Mở System Preferences > Network.
  2. Chọn kết nối mạng đang sử dụng (Wi-Fi hoặc Ethernet).
  3. Nhấp vào Advanced và chuyển đến tab TCP/IP.
  4. Đảm bảo Configure IPv4 được đặt thành Using DHCP.
  5. Trong tab DNS, thêm các máy chủ DNS của Google (8.8.8.8 và 8.8.4.4) nếu cần.

3. Các giải pháp nâng cao

3.1 Đặt lại stack TCP/IP

Trên Windows, mở Command Prompt với quyền admin và chạy các lệnh sau:

netsh int ip reset
netsh winsock reset
ipconfig /flushdns
        

Sau đó khởi động lại máy tính.

3.2 Cập nhật hoặc cài đặt lại driver mạng

Driver mạng cũ hoặc bị hỏng có thể gây ra vấn đề kết nối:

  1. Mở Device Manager (nhấn Win + X và chọn Device Manager).
  2. Mở rộng mục Network adapters.
  3. Nhấp chuột phải vào card mạng (Wi-Fi hoặc Ethernet) và chọn Update driver.
  4. Nếu cập nhật không giải quyết được, chọn Uninstall device, sau đó khởi động lại máy tính để Windows cài đặt lại driver.

3.3 Thay đổi cài đặt DNS

DNS của nhà cung cấp dịch vụ đôi khi gặp sự cố. Thay đổi sang DNS công cộng như Google DNS hoặc Cloudflare DNS có thể giúp ích:

  • Google DNS: 8.8.8.8 và 8.8.4.4
  • Cloudflare DNS: 1.1.1.1 và 1.0.0.1

3.4 Tắt tường lửa và phần mềm diệt virus tạm thời

Đôi khi tường lửa hoặc phần mềm diệt virus có thể chặn kết nối internet:

  1. Tạm thời tắt Windows Defender Firewall hoặc phần mềm diệt virus của bên thứ ba.
  2. Kiểm tra xem internet có hoạt động trở lại không.
  3. Nếu có, hãy cấu hình lại tường lửa hoặc phần mềm diệt virus để cho phép kết nối.

3.5 Kiểm tra xâm nhập malware

Malware có thể thay đổi cài đặt mạng của bạn. Sử dụng các công cụ như:

  • Malwarebytes
  • Windows Defender Offline Scan
  • Kaspersky Virus Removal Tool

Để quét toàn bộ hệ thống.

4. Khi nào nên liên hệ với ISP

Nếu bạn đã thử tất cả các giải pháp trên mà vẫn không khắc phục được, vấn đề có thể nằm ở phía nhà cung cấp dịch vụ internet (ISP). Hãy liên hệ với họ nếu:

  • Tất cả các thiết bị trong mạng đều không thể kết nối internet.
  • Đèn Internet trên modem/router không sáng hoặc nhấp nháy bất thường.
  • Bạn nhận được thông báo lỗi như “DNS_PROBE_FINISHED_NO_INTERNET” hoặc “ERR_INTERNET_DISCONNECTED” trên tất cả các thiết bị.
  • Bạn không thể ping được địa chỉ IP công cộng (ví dụ: 8.8.8.8).

5. So sánh các nguyên nhân phổ biến

Bảng dưới đây tóm tắt các nguyên nhân phổ biến và giải pháp tương ứng:

Nguyên nhân Triệu chứng Giải pháp Mức độ phổ biến
Lỗi cấu hình IP IP bắt đầu bằng 169.254.x.x Đặt lại TCP/IP, khởi động lại router Rất phổ biến
Lỗi DNS Ping IP thành công nhưng không ping được tên miền Thay đổi DNS, flush DNS cache Phổ biến
Driver mạng lỗi thời Kết nối ngắt quãng, tốc độ chậm Cập nhật hoặc cài đặt lại driver Phổ biến
Sự cố từ ISP Tất cả thiết bị không vào được mạng Liên hệ ISP, kiểm tra thông báo sự cố Ít phổ biến
Malware Cài đặt mạng bị thay đổi, quảng cáo bất thường Quét malware, đặt lại cài đặt mạng Ít phổ biến

6. Thống kê về sự cố kết nối internet

Theo báo cáo từ Liên minh Viễn thông Quốc tế (ITU), các sự cố kết nối internet phổ biến nhất bao gồm:

Loại sự cố Tỷ lệ (%) Thời gian trung bình khắc phục (phút)
Lỗi cấu hình IP 32% 5-10
Sự cố DNS 22% 3-8
Driver mạng 18% 10-15
Sự cố phần cứng (cáp, router) 15% 15-30
Sự cố từ ISP 10% 30-120
Malware 3% 20-45

Nguồn: ITU Statistics 2023

7. Các công cụ chẩn đoán hữu ích

Dưới đây là một số công cụ miễn phí giúp chẩn đoán sự cố mạng:

  • Wireshark: Phân tích gói tin mạng chi tiết.
  • PingPlotter: Theo dõi đường đi của gói tin và độ trễ.
  • GlassWire: Giám sát sử dụng băng thông và kết nối mạng.
  • NetSpot: Phân tích mạng Wi-Fi và tìm kênh tối ưu.

8. Phòng ngừa sự cố trong tương lai

Để giảm thiểu khả năng gặp phải sự cố kết nối:

  • Cập nhật hệ điều hành và driver mạng thường xuyên.
  • Sử dụng bộ định tuyến chất lượng cao với firmware mới nhất.
  • Thiết lập sao lưu cài đặt mạng quan trọng.
  • Sử dụng nguồn điện ổn định (UPS) cho modem và router.
  • Thường xuyên quét malware và giữ phần mềm diệt virus cập nhật.
  • Ghi lại các thay đổi cấu hình mạng để dễ dàng khôi phục khi cần.

9. Khi nào nên tìm đến chuyên gia

Hãy cân nhắc liên hệ với chuyên gia CNTT nếu:

  • Bạn đã thử tất cả các giải pháp trên mà vẫn không khắc phục được.
  • Sự cố xảy ra thường xuyên mà không có nguyên nhân rõ ràng.
  • Bạn nghi ngờ mạng của mình bị xâm nhập hoặc tấn công.
  • Bạn cần thiết lập mạng phức tạp (VLAN, VPN, v.v.).

Theo khuyến cáo từ CISA (Cybersecurity and Infrastructure Security Agency), người dùng nên thực hiện các biện pháp bảo mật mạng cơ bản và cập nhật kiến thức về an toàn thông tin để phòng ngừa các sự cố kết nối cũng như các mối đe dọa bảo mật tiềm ẩn.

10. Kết luận

Vấn đề “máy tính có mạng nhưng không kết nối được internet” có thể xuất phát từ nhiều nguyên nhân khác nhau, từ đơn giản đến phức tạp. Bằng cách làm theo các bước chẩn đoán và khắc phục trong bài viết này, bạn có thể xác định và giải quyết hầu hết các sự cố phổ biến. Hãy bắt đầu từ các giải pháp đơn giản nhất trước khi tiến đến các phương pháp phức tạp hơn. Nếu sự cố vẫn tiếp diễn, đừng ngần ngại liên hệ với nhà cung cấp dịch vụ internet hoặc chuyên gia CNTT để được hỗ trợ chuyên sâu.

Nhớ rằng, việc duy trì thói quen bảo trì mạng định kỳ và cập nhật kiến thức về công nghệ mạng sẽ giúp bạn phòng ngừa và xử lý các sự cố hiệu quả hơn trong tương lai.

Leave a Reply

Your email address will not be published. Required fields are marked *